Overview of SNAP Exam Before diving into preparation, let’s familiarize ourselves with the crucial details of the SNAP exam: Eligibility Criteria To appear for SNAP 2024, candidates must meet the following criteria: General/OBC candidates must obtain 55% marks. Minimally, 45% mark in the case of SC/ST candidates. It also applies to the students enrolled in the final year, but they must ensure they get the required percentage before graduating. Foreign nationals, PIO, and NRI candidates need certification from the Association of Indian Universities (AIU) and must appear for English proficiency tests like IELTS or IELA. SNAP 2024 Registration Process The SNAP 2024 registration starts on August 5 and ends on November 22 of the year 2024. Aspiring candidates are required to fill out an online form available through the Social Anthropology Programme website. Steps to Register: Go to the official SNAP website. You will see a button “Apply Now.” Provide your personal and academic information and use a valid email ID and mobile number. You should provide a recent photo and signature. Submit the application fee to confirm registration. Important: It must also be noted that once the form has been submitted, there is no way to change the details filled in the application. SNAP 2024 Admit Card The admit card for each SNAP session will be released separately. The admit card must be downloaded from the official website, provided that the candidate is writing the test for the particular session. It is important to note that a physical copy of the admit card is required to enter the exam hall. SNAP 2024 Results SNAP results will be displayed on 8th January 2025. The candidate scorecards can also be downloaded from the official website up to February 2025. The scorecard will indicate the performance of this candidate, as indicated later in the current document. SNAP 2024 Selection Process After the results are received, eligible candidates will proceed to the next rounds: writing ability test (WAT), group exercise (GE), and Personal Interview (PI). The cut-offs for the participating institutes will be announced. The final merit list will be based on: SNAP Score (50%) Group Exercise (10%) Personal Interview (30%) Writing Ability Test (10%) Preparation Tips for SNAP 2025 Understand the Exam Pattern Learn about the types of questions on the SNAP exam, sections, mark allocation, and the time limit.
